Kirklees College moves online following Coronavirus outbreak

Following the Government announcement, Kirklees College has moved all teaching, learning and working online.

Following the Government announcement that from Friday 20 March all colleges will be closed until further notice, Kirklees College has moved all teaching, learning and working online for the foreseeable future.

At this stage, it cannot be confirmed when Kirklees College will reopen. However, the college will be working hard to ensure that all students, particularly the most vulnerable, remain supported at this very difficult and challenging time.

The college is issuing the latest guidance to all students, parents, carers, staff and employers via email and the VLE and the Department for Education launched a new helpline to answer any questions about COVID-19 related to education. Staff, parents and young people can contact the helpline every weekday between 8am and 6pm by calling 0800 046 8687 or emailing coronavirushelpline@education.gov.uk

Vice Principal, Carmen Gonzalez-Eslava praised and thanked all staff on behalf of the College. She said “you have all embraced the numerous communications, responded swiftly to all requests, worked together brilliantly and, above all, put our learners first.”
